Christmas Eve Arrest Made in North Reading Armed Robberies

Police allege that Peter Dolan twice robbed the Tedeschi's in North Reading while armed with a knife.

Police have arrested a 29-year-old Billerica man in connected with two recent armed robberies at Tedeschi's Convenience Store in North Reading. Peter Dolan also faces charges stemming from an attempted robbery at a convenience store in Chelmsford, according to a press release from the North Reading Police Department. North Reading Police Detectives along with Chelmsford Police Detectives arrested Dolan on Christmas Eve without incident. After his arrest, Dolan was held at Chelmsford Police Headquarters on Christmas Day and arraigned on the Chelmsford charges on Wednesday, Dec. 26, according to the press release. North Reading Tedeschi Robbed Again at Knifepoint

According to police, the same suspect involved in a November robbery may have been the man who held up the store early Sunday morning.

State and local police searched the area around Tedeschi's Food Store after an overnight robbery that officers believe may be linked to a previous incident at the store. North Reading police received a call that the store had been held up at knifepoint at about 12:15 a.m. on Sunday. The involved party fled on foot and was believed to have left the area in a green colored sedan, possibly a Honda, before cruisers arrived. According to public safety transmissions, the suspect displayed a knife with a green handle before he left toward the rear of the store. K-9 units were called in from State Police, but officers were unable to locate the party. Armed Robbery in Reading Thursday Night

The Gulf Station on Main Street was robbed at gunpoint.

According to WCVB.com, the Gulf Station on Main Street was robbed late Thursday night. No injuries were reported. The suspect was armed and believed to be the same person who recently robbed stores in Melrose, Stoneham and Woburn, WCVB.com said. State police assisted Reading Police to track the suspect, but no arrests have been made. Check in with us for updates.

P & S Convenient Store Robbed at Knifepoint

A male suspect made off with an unknown amount of cash after showing the cashier a knife.

The P & S Convenient Store on Lowell Street was robbed Friday night, by a man wearing a black ski mask and brandishing a black folding knife with a jagged edge. An unknown sum of money was taken and no one was hurt. At approximately 8:46 p.m., a male suspect, described as between 19 and 25 years old, with brown eyes, a stocky build and olive or tan complexion entered the store and showed the clerk the knife and demanded money, which was duly turned over in an unknown amount. The suspect then fled in a motor vehicle. Additional descriptive information puts the suspect at around 5-foot-8 inches tall, left-handed with black bushy eyebrows, wearing a black ski hat and mask, dark blue jeans and tan boots. Attempted Armed Robbery at North Shore Printing Thursday

A white male reportedly attempted to rob North Shore Printing at knifepoint.

At 4:30 p.m. on Thursday a white male attempted to rob North Shore Printing at knifepoint.  According to North Reading police, the manager of North Shore Printing reported that a white male, approximately 18-years-old with dark hair, wearing a gray hooded sweatshirt and dark pants showed a knife and demanded money. He did not get any money from the business, police said. A witness told police he saw a male matching the description run across the North Shore Printing parking lot and get into a silver vehicle, possible an Audi. The vehicle then fled toward Andover on Main Street. Approximately 30 minutes later, Silver Cleaners in North Andover was robbed at knifepoint.
